Bollards are vertical posts, usually made of steel, concrete, or plastic, that are used to control and regulate vehicle access. Bollards can be installed permanently or in a removable form. Installed bollards prevent vehicles from entering a specified area, such as a kindergarten, and protect against both intentional and accidental vehicle damage.

When considering security for a kindergarten, bollards are an ideal solution for restricting access to unauthorized vehicles. Bollards offer an effective barrier that prevents vehicles from entering the kindergarten, while still allowing pedestrian access. In addition, bollards can be used in conjunction with other security measures, such as gates and fences, to create a comprehensive security system.

Bollards come in a variety of materials and sizes, allowing them to be tailored to suit the specific security needs of the kindergarten. Bollards can also be used to protect against accidental vehicle damage

Vehicles can cause significant damage to property, and kindergarten are especially vulnerable. Installing bollards is an effective way to protect them from accidental vehicle damage, as they create a barrier between the vehicle and the building. Bollards can also be used to mark areas where vehicles are not allowed, reducing the chances of a vehicle running into an area it shouldn’t.

In addition, bollards can provide a visual warning for drivers, alerting them to the fact that they are entering an area where vehicles are not permitted. This is especially important for those areas that are more vulnerable, such as playgrounds and outdoor spaces.

Bollards also help to provide an additional layer of protection for pedestrians and cyclists, as they create a physical barrier between these vulnerable road users and the road. This helps to reduce the risk of accidents and potential injury.
